What should a hail damage estimate template include for North Carolina insurance claims?
A compliant NC hail damage estimate should include the property address, date of loss, storm event documentation, itemized line items for roof decking, shingles, gutters, and flashings, Xactimate or Symbility pricing for your NC region, depreciation calculations, contractor license number (required in NC), and a signed certificate of completion section. Including hail size and weather report references strengthens carrier approval rates.
Do North Carolina contractors need a special license to submit hail damage estimates?
Yes. North Carolina requires roofing contractors to hold a General Contractor license from the NC Licensing Board for General Contractors for projects over $30,000, and a Roofing Specialty license for smaller jobs. Your license number must appear on all estimates and contracts submitted to insurers. Some carriers also require you to be listed as an approved vendor, so verify requirements with each insurance company before submitting a hail claim estimate.
